Free Estimate
Gary V.

We had a great experience! Our salesman, the installation crew, outstanding. I highly recommend this Company for their product and services.

Share on Facebook Share on Twitter Share on LinkedIn Share via Email

All reviews

Schedule your free estimate today!

Request appointment?

40 Years

144,889+

Happy Customers

BBB Torch Awards